    Have someone at a bike shop size you and tell you what size you need. And I'm not talking about REI or any generic place like that. I have a friend who bought a bike that was WAY too big for her at REI. Lucky for her REI takes returns any time, no questions asked.

    And when someone who knows what they're doing adjusts your seat, don't move it down so you can reach the ground while sitting in the saddle at a stop light. This same friend did this and it severely messed with her riding. You shouldn't be able to sit on the saddle with your leg on the ground.
